Pomegranate juice recipe

It is advantageous for a variety of medical disorders. Pomegranate juice is abundant in antioxidants, vitamin C, vitamin B5, and potassium, and studies have shown that it is beneficial in lowering LDL (bad cholesterol) and elevating HDL (good cholesterol). Fresh pomegranate fruit juice is not only nutritious but also quick and simple to make at home with a blender (without a juicer).

Homemade Pomegranate juice or Anar juice is much better, lighter, and tastier than store-bought Pomegranate juice or Anar juice. It has a sweet, tart flavor and a vibrant deep red color. You will never purchase a carton again if you make it at home just once, I can guarantee that.

Pomegranate juice is one of the healthiest juices. Homemade juice is not only highly tasty but also free of added sugar, artificial flavors, colors, and preservatives. Making it at home is also significantly more affordable.

Ingredients for pomegranate juice

  • 2 medium to large pomegranates
  • 1 pinch black salt, optional
  • 1/2 cup Water

Instructions for pomegranate juice

  1. Pomegranate washed; patted dry. To remove the crown, cut it at the top (flower shaped portion on top). Make two shallow slashes through the outer skin, going from top to bottom. Slice the fruit in half, then scoop out the seeds.
  2. Put 1 cup of pomegranate seeds in the container of the blender.Pour a half-cup of water.
  3. Blend it briefly until the outer covering of seeds breaks down and the juice comes out.
  4. Because the juice becomes bitter if the seeds totally shatter, only pulse it, rather than blending it.
  5. To filter the juice, take a sizable basin and set the metal strainer over it. Over it, pour prepared juice. You can strain the juice using a clean muslin cloth or a nut milk bag if a metal strainer is not available.
  6. To squeeze as much juice out of the pulp, use the back of a spoon.
  7. Throw away the leftover seeds and pulp (or mix some salt with it and enjoy it alone).
  8. For extra vitamins, antioxidants, and other nutritional components, immediately pour the prepared juice into a serving glass.

Notes

For a great flavour, you can add some lime juice, pink salt, or black salt to it.

Anar juice can occasionally be exceedingly heavy to consume. Mix it with some water, club soda, or seltzer in that situation.

Anytime you handle pomegranates, wear old clothes or an apron. Their stains are difficult to remove from the fabric. Additionally, try collecting the seeds in a steel or glass bowl using an old cutting board. Plastic bowls have stains on them that won’t go away.

Serving Suggestions

It is the ideal morning or post-workout beverage because it is packed with essential nutrients and gets your body ready for a busy day. Serve it in moderation to young children who are still growing.
